Output 6823639d58617b3a7dfd53e43a284437008e91a67b193937b184086bffc7ab61:3

value
36790118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69ec358b0faa56320212ccd04102538158c7fa93 OP_EQUALVERIFY OP_CHECKSIG
address
1Af4vF2gSjSejE4YHsXRrWrXA6pVsdX8rD
transaction
6823639d58617b3a7dfd53e43a284437008e91a67b193937b184086bffc7ab61
confirmations
392170
spent
true